Leading taiwanese manufacturers of laptops, All-in-one PCs, tablets, graphics cards, and motherboards MSI (Micro-Star International), recently announced the appointment of Steven Chen as Regional Sales Director for the notebook division at MSI headquarters in Taipei. In his new role Steven Chen will oversee the strategy to expand the MSI business in emerging markets. MSI today unveiled its two new gaming laptops GT780DXR and GT683DXR part of G Series family of gaming laptops featuring the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 570M graphics processing unit (GPU). The new laptops are designed for the serious gamer seeking unmatched power with an unprecedented immersive experience.
